April 30, 2021 Tagansky Court Moscow satisfied the claim of the Moscow prosecutor's office for the recognition of the book of the Bishop of the Orthodox Church of the Mother of God "Sovereign" John (Bereslavsky) "Rose of the Seraphs. Bogomilskoe gospel" extremist literature.
Recall experts from the Center sociocultural initiatives Natalia Kryukova (mathematician, candidate of pedagogical Sciences), Alexander Tarasov (linguist-translator, candidate of political sciences) and Viktor Kotelnikov (political scientist, religious scholar, candidate of political sciences) came to concluded that the text of the book contains " statements about the superiority or inferiority of people in depending on their religious affiliation ”, as well as “ calls for the introduction of restrictions or preferences of family relations for a group identified on a religious basis "(in the examination, we are talking about the preaching of monasticism and / or church marriage).
At the same time the defense found , that 18 text fragments analyzed during the examination were not taken from the Rose seraphs." Kryukova confirmed that these passages were taken from other publications, however this fact did not affect the decision of the court.
From our point of view, there are no grounds for banning "Rose of the Seraphites" as an extremist material (more on our position can be found here ).
